Contemporary art museum set in a former school. It presents changing exhibitions in an intimate setting close to the seafront.
Open-air sculpture park in the Zwin area with works integrated into the dunes. It combines coastal walking with contemporary art.
Gallery space dedicated to the surreal world of René Magritte. A worthwhile stop for visitors interested in Belgian modern art.
Major nature reserve of dunes, mudflats and bird habitats on the Dutch border. Excellent for walking, wildlife watching and broad coastal views.
Long sandy beach backed by a lively promenade. Ideal for sea views, walking, and experiencing the classic resort atmosphere of Knokke-Heist.
Elegant avenue lined with boutiques, galleries and fine architecture. It is one of the town’s best-known streets for strolling and people-watching.
Grey shrimp croquettes are a Belgian coast classic: crisp fried croquettes with North Sea shrimp and a creamy filling, especially associated with seaside dining.
Moules marinières are mussels cooked with white wine, celery and onion. North Sea mussels are a staple in coastal Belgium and widely eaten in Knokke-Heist.
Tomatoes stuffed with tiny North Sea grey shrimps and mayonnaise are a classic Belgian starter, popular along the coast for their fresh local seafood flavour.

Knokke-Heist is pricier than many Belgian seaside towns, with higher hotel and dining costs in peak season, though local trains keep transport reasonable.
Service is usually included. Rounding up or leaving 5-10% for excellent restaurant service is appreciated. Round up taxi fares; small change for cafés is optional.
